A Study to Assess Immune Response to Multiple Doses of PF-06881894 or US-Approved Neulasta in Healthy Volunteers

NCT03273842 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E1 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 422

Last updated 2018-09-05

No results posted yet for this study

Summary

This study compares the immune response to the proposed biosimilar PF-06881894 and the US-approved Neulasta reference product. Subjects will receive 2 subcutaneous injections (6 milligrams \[mg\]) either 1 of the 2 study drugs. Subjects will receive the first dose on Day 1 of Period 1 and the second dose on Day 1 of Period 2. Pre-dose and serial post-dose assessments of immunogenicity will be conducted each of the two treatment periods. In addition, safety assessments will be conducted throughout the study.
